Narco Test Approved for Main Accused in Gumla Missing Girl Case, HC Summons Top Officials

Ranchi: The Jharkhand High Court heard the habeas corpus petition filed by Chandramuni Urain, mother of a six-year-old girl missing from Gumla since September 2018. The state government informed the court that the CJM court in Gumla had on June 17 granted permission for a narco test of the main accused, which will be conducted in Gujarat. The CJM court has also issued necessary directions to the police administration regarding the procedure. The next hearing has been fixed for July 9.

HC Summons Chief Secretary, Home Secretary and DGP

During the hearing, the government had filed an intervention application seeking modification of a High Court order dated May 12, 2026. The court questioned the purpose of filing such a petition in the High Court when the government had earlier filed an SLP in the Supreme Court on the same issue and then withdrawn it. The court summoned the Chief Secretary, Home Secretary, and DGP at 2:15 pm, all three of whom appeared before the bench. The court sought responses from all three officials and ultimately dismissed the government’s intervention application seeking modification of the order.
